This water-soluble polymer is highly versatile and can be dissolved in water in varying proportions for various Baddi based projects. It exhibits exceptional stability as a high-polymer electrolyte in neutral and alkaline mediums. Its unique chemical structure allows it to cross-link into insoluble gels when reacting with high-valence metal ions, making it superior for complex separation tasks.
1. Industrial Wastewater Treatment: Specifically designed for neutral to alkaline wastewater (pH 7-14) containing large suspended particles with positive charges. It is highly effective in Baddi's industrial sectors, including Iron & Steel, Electroplating units, Metallurgical plants, and Coal washing facilities.
2. Drinking Water Clarification: Used as a high-performance flocculant for municipal water projects in Baddi when traditional filtration isn't enough. The dosage required is only 2-5% of inorganic flocculants, yet the results are significantly more powerful, ensuring crystal clear water quality.
3. Starch & Alcohol Industry: Efficiently used for the recovery of lost brewers' grains in alcohol plants and starch ion recovery in starch factories across Baddi, reducing waste and improving yield.
4. Oil & Gas Sector: Serves as an effective water-blocking agent in oil fields and acts as a high-efficiency oil-displacing agent during Tertiary Oil Recovery (EOR) processes near Baddi.
5. Paper Manufacturing: Widely applied in Baddi's paper industry as a dispersant and retention aid for long-fiber paper making, as well as a primary flocculant for treating paper mill effluent.
